Moisture Mapping Methods

Various techniques are utilized for Moisture Mapping:

  • Infrared Thermography: Infrared cameras detect temperature variations, revealing moisture-related patterns.
  • Capacitance Probe: Non-destructive probes measure moisture levels in materials by detecting permittivity changes.
  • Microwave Scanning: High-frequency microwaves penetrate materials, indicating moisture presence through changes in signal strength.
  • Acoustic Testing: Sound waves analyze material density, identifying moisture-induced variations.
  • Electrical Resistance: Moisture increases electrical conductivity, enabling detection via specialized instruments.

How Does Moisture Mapping Work?

Moisture Mapping follows these steps:

1. Data Collection: Technicians gather moisture data using specialized equipment for the chosen technique.
2. Analysis: Data is processed to create moisture maps, visually representing moisture distribution.
3. Interpretation: Experts analyze moisture maps, identifying areas of concern and determining root causes.
4. Reporting: Detailed reports provide moisture levels, analysis, and recommendations for remediation.

Benefits of Moisture Mapping

Moisture Mapping offers several advantages:

  • Early Detection: Identifies moisture problems before severe damage occurs.
  • Targeted Maintenance: Enables precise targeting of maintenance efforts, minimizing disruption and costs.
  • Improved Building Performance: Optimizes building performance by addressing moisture-related issues, enhancing energy efficiency and indoor air quality.
  • Insurance Compliance: Provides documentation for insurance claims related to moisture damage.
